Secret Factors to Consider When Buying a Mobility Scooter
Type of Scooter
3-Wheel Scooters: Ideal for indoor use and tight areas. They are more maneuverable but might provide less stability on irregular terrain.4-Wheel Scooters: Better suited for outdoor usage and rougher surface. They supply more stability and can support heavier weights.
Range and Speed
Range: Consider how far you need to take a trip. Some scooters can go up to 30 miles on a single charge, while others might have a much shorter range.Speed: Most mobility scooters have a maximum speed of 4-8 miles per hour, however this can differ based on the design and your specific needs.
Weight Capacity
Ensure the scooter can support your weight. Models normally range from 250 to 500 pounds.
Portability
If you prepare to carry your scooter often, look for models that are lightweight and can be easily disassembled. Some scooters even suit the trunk of a car.
Safety Features
Brakes: Look for scooters with trustworthy braking systems.Lights: Rear and front lights can improve visibility, particularly crucial if you prepare to use the scooter at night or in low-light conditions.Seat: Ergonomic seats with adjustable functions can substantially improve comfort and assistance.
Service Warranty and Customer Support

Q: How do I select the best rated mobility scooter size and type of mobility scooter?
A: Consider your main use (indoor or outside), weight, and the kind of terrain you will be navigating. 3-wheel scooters are better for indoor usage, while 4-wheel scooters are preferable for outside adventures.
Q: Are mobility scooters easy to utilize?
A: Yes, many mobility scooters are developed with easy to use controls and are simple to operate. Numerous models feature educational handbooks and can be customized to suit your particular needs.
Q: How much do mobility scooters cost?
A: Prices can vary commonly depending on the model and functions. Entry-level scooters can cost around ₤ 500, while high-end designs with innovative features can be priced over ₤ 3,000.
Q: Can I get a mobility scooter through insurance coverage?
A: Some insurance coverage plans, including Medicare, may cover the expense of a mobility scooter under particular conditions. Consult your insurance service provider to see if you qualify.

Q: Are there any legal requirements for using a mobility scooter?
A: While there are generally no specific licenses needed, you ought to know regional regulations. Some locations may have guidelines about where and how mobility scooters can be used, such as on pathways or in public areas.Leading 5 Mobility Scooter Models to Consider
